(* Compilation of pattern-matching *)
open Typedtree
open Lambda
open Debuginfo.Scoped_location
(* Entry points to match compiler *)
val for_function:
scopes:scopes -> Location.t ->
int ref option -> lambda -> (pattern * lambda) list -> partial ->
lambda
val for_trywith:
scopes:scopes -> Location.t ->
lambda -> (pattern * lambda) list ->
lambda
val for_handler:
scopes:scopes -> Location.t ->
lambda -> lambda -> lambda -> (pattern * lambda) list ->
lambda
val for_let:
scopes:scopes -> Location.t ->
lambda -> pattern -> lambda ->
lambda
val for_multiple_match:
scopes:scopes -> Location.t ->
lambda list -> (pattern * lambda) list -> partial ->
lambda
val for_tupled_function:
scopes:scopes -> Location.t ->
Ident.t list -> (pattern list * lambda) list -> partial ->
lambda
(** [for_optional_arg_default pat body ~default_arg ~param] is:
{[
let $pat =
match $param with
| Some x -> x
| None -> $default_arg
in
$body
]}
*)
val for_optional_arg_default:
scopes:scopes -> Location.t ->
pattern -> default_arg:lambda -> param:Ident.t -> lambda ->
lambda
exception Cannot_flatten
val flatten_pattern: int -> pattern -> pattern list
(* Expand stringswitch to string test tree *)
val expand_stringswitch:
scoped_location -> lambda -> (string * lambda) list ->
lambda option -> lambda
val inline_lazy_force : lambda -> scoped_location -> lambda
